    Inside New York New York hotel, this was some of the best Mexican food we ate on the strip. Luckily we stayed at this hotel so we had tried several restaurants there. Casual dining Mexican meets flavor is best way to describe it. You think it's your typical Tex-Mex spot until the salsa hit the table. Instead of the traditional red salsa, we got black/green salsa that was great. We're accustomed to chips and salsa coming with the meal but having to pay for it was different indeed. But I'm glad we ordered it. I wish they sold the salsa by the jar. It had a slight kick to it but the fresh chips paired really well with it. I went with the ground beef chimichanga, which is my standard order. I made sure to ask for black beans instead of refried beans. My chimichanga came straight from the fryer to the table it was so hot. But it was really good. Plenty of meat inside with good toppings on top. The black beans were ok but definitely better than the refried ones my mom got. The rice was flavorful as well. Overall, we really enjoyed our food and hate we waited late into the trip to try them, as it didn't allow for us to return to eat there a second time.

    We came here while in New York, New York and ordered the three dip plate with guacamole on the side. They bring you salsa and chips so we basically had five dips to try. The guac was kinda mild but smooth and tasted good. The sour cream was really good and I usually don't love it. The bean dip was very warm and tasted amazing it was kinda grainy but good. None of us really liked the queso because it was too Smokey and tasted off. The salsa was way too runny for me and didn't have much flavor in my opinion, that's also the only sauce we did not finish. The chips were very warm, had a good amount of salt, and were crispy. [[HIGHLIGHT]]The atmosphere was very Hispanic with the decorations and stuff being shown on the TVs.[[ENDHIGHLIGHT]] [[HIGHLIGHT]]The ceiling was exposed to the New York, New York ceiling.[[ENDHIGHLIGHT]]

    What's better than people watching in Las Vegas? Well, it's people watching while eating tacos, of course. Lucky for me on a Tuesday afternoon, this restaurant was serving up quick food in a casual "courtyard" area where you could sit and have fun watching.. I was hanging around in NY NY and needed a snack and for some reason, the 3 crispy tacos jumped off the menu (not literally as I was not on LSD... yet). The tacos were delicious with a crispy fried non-corn taco shell that wasn't greasy at all. They didn't get soggy either which was nice (I ate them fairly quickly though). They could have used more cheese, but it wasn't a pathetic amount like some places. The cilantro rice and black beans were bland AF though. Nothing special about them at all. I took a few bites and stopped. Service was good with some water refills coming quickly. I was in an out in about 20 mins during non-peak hours.

    When are latin nights?

    Hi! Latin nights are Friday and Saturday night from 11pm-3am.

    Is it a family restaurant where children are welcome?

    Yes, children are welcome. When I dined in, there were families with kids having dinner.

    Do you need reservations for latin nights?

    Hi! Reservations for Latin nights are not required unless you would like bottle service.

    What's the dress code?

    It's casual and laid back. No strict dress code.
